The Protective Role of Hyaluronic Acid in Cr(VI)-Induced Oxidative Damage in Corneal Epithelial Cells

摘要

Cr(VI) exposure could produce kinds of intermediates and reactive oxygen species, both of which were related to DNA damage. Hyaluronan (HA) has impressive biological functions and was reported to protect corneal epithelial cells against oxidative damage induced by ultraviolet B, benzalkonium chloride, and sodium lauryl sulfate. So the aim of our study was to investigate HA protection on human corneal epithelial (HCE) cells against Cr(VI)-induced toxic effects. The HCE cell lines were exposed to different concentrations of K2Cr2O7 (1.875, 3.75, 7.5, 15.0, and 30 μM) or a combination of K2Cr2O7 and 0.2% HA and incubated with different times (15 min, 30 min, and 60 min). Our data showed that Cr(VI) exposure could cause decreased cell viability, increased DNA damage, and ROS generation to the HCE cell lines. But incubation of HA increased HCE cell survival rates and decreased DNA damage and ROS generation induced by Cr(VI) in a dose- and time-dependent manner. We report for the first time that HA can protect HCE cells against the toxicity of Cr(VI), indicating that it will be a promising therapeutic agent to corneal injuries caused by Cr(VI).
机译:六价铬的暴露可能会产生各种中间体和活性氧,两者均与DNA损伤有关。透明质酸(HA)具有令人印象深刻的生物学功能,据报道可保护角膜上皮细胞免受紫外线B,苯扎氯铵和十二烷基硫酸钠诱导的氧化损伤。因此,我们的研究目的是研究HA对人角膜上皮(HCE)细胞的保护作用,以防止Cr(VI)诱导的毒性作用。将HCE细胞系暴露于不同浓度的K2Cr2O7(1.875、3.75、7.5、15.0和30μm)或K2Cr2O7和0.2%HA的组合,并用不同的时间孵育(15分钟,30分钟和60分钟)。我们的数据表明,Cr(VI)暴露可能会导致细胞活力降低,DNA损伤增加以及HCE细胞系产生ROS。但是,HA的孵育以剂量和时间依赖性方式增加了Cr(VI)诱导的HCE细胞存活率并降低了DNA损伤和ROS生成。我们首次报道HA可以保护HCE细胞免受Cr(VI)的毒性,这表明它将是一种有希望的治疗剂来治疗Cr(VI)引起的角膜损伤。
